Storage and Leftovers
Store in an airtight container.
Keep refrigerated for up to one week.
Freeze for up to three months.
Allow frozen cakes to thaw before serving.

PrintCopycat Dot Cakes: Easy Homemade Chocolate Snack Cakes
Copycat Dot Cakes are rich, moist chocolate cake bites coated in a smooth chocolate shell. These homemade treats are perfect for parties, lunchboxes, bake sales, and dessert trays.
- Prep Time: 30 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
- Total Time: 1 hour
- Yield: 24 cakes 1x
Ingredients
- 1 box chocolate cake mix
- 3 large eggs
- 1/2 cup vegetable oil
- 1 cup water
- 1 cup chocolate frosting
- 2 cups semi-sweet chocolate chips
- 2 tablespoons coconut oil
- Sprinkles for decoration (optional)
Instructions
- Prepare and bake chocolate cake according to package directions.
- Allow cake to cool completely.
- Crumble cake into fine crumbs.
- Mix cake crumbs with frosting until combined.
- Roll mixture into small balls.
- Place on a baking sheet and freeze for 20 minutes.
- Melt chocolate chips and coconut oil until smooth.
- Dip each cake ball into melted chocolate.
- Place on parchment paper.
- Add decorations if desired.
- Allow chocolate coating to set completely.
- Serve or store in an airtight container.
Notes
- Freeze cake balls before dipping for easier handling.
- Use quality chocolate for the best flavor.
- Decorate immediately after coating.
- Store refrigerated for freshness.
- Can be frozen for up to 3 months.
- Try different cake flavors for variety.
- Use melting wafers for a smoother coating.
- Avoid overheating chocolate.
- Work in batches if necessary.
- Allow coating to fully set before serving.
